    Recent Developments in Mechatronics and Intelligent Robotics: Proceedings of International Conference on Mechatronics and Intelligent Robotics (ICMIR2018) by Kevin Deng
    English | PDF | 2019 | 1291 Pages | ISBN : 3030002136 | 157.5 MB

    This book is a collection of proceedings of the International Conference on Mechatronics and Intelligent Robotics (ICMIR2018), held in Kunming, China during May 19–20, 2018. It consists of 155 papers, which have been categorized into 6 different sections: Intelligent Systems, Robotics, Intelligent Sensors & Actuators, Mechatronics, Computational Vision and Machine Learning, and Soft Computing.
